Ideal L61 Fault Code
The Ideal L61 fault code means: your heat pump has detected an electrical fault within the wiring or the motor that drives the system, causing it to shut down to prevent damage.. It appears on 1 Ideal model in our database.
Technical description: Short Circuit to Compressor Terminals
What causes the Ideal L61 fault?
This fault occurs when the electrical current flowing to the heart of the heat pump is interrupted or takes a dangerous shortcut. It is most commonly caused by damaged internal wiring or an electrical failure within the compressor motor itself, which triggers a safety shutdown. Over time, vibration or moisture can wear down the insulation on these components, leading to this electrical malfunction.
